HDMI Cable - No Sound L42WD22 RCA Flat Panel TV

I purchased a RCA L42WD22 Flat panel TV. I hooked up an HDMI cable and have picture - I do not have sound. I've read the only fix is to take to repair shop. Is there an alternate solution. Thank you.

No sound and a digital picture. i will assume you have no signal on analog rf cable. Thomson(RCA) have been having problem with these sets. The trouble stems from the digital cuircit board. We see alot of these. You used to get the digital board.. they are not availble.. so rca found the component on these that fail.. A VERY SMALL surface mounted fuse. With a lighted magnifer and some fine tip twezzers. we replace these fuses on these boards. Do you have any soldering experence..

I tried hooking up my laptop to my 37lh20 tv. I connected the avi to the pc input and an audio cable fro the headset jack on the tv. If I put the tv input on rgb pc I get the picture but no sound and if...

Unless you hook HDMI to HDMI, you won't carry sound across the HDMI cable. If you're using a VGA to HDMI converter, you'll get the picture but no sound.

I have a feeling the headset jack on the TV is an output rather than an input. Most TVs accept HDMI, RCA, or a digital audio input (either coaxial or optical). Unless you have a S/PDIF optical output from your laptop (and you obviously don't have an HDMI output), then your only other choice is likely to get a cable that splits a 1/8" headset type connector into two RCA plugs that you'll plug into an AUDIO IN input on your TV.
